TRIMMING THE FUR

-

Saks Fifth Avenue plans to phase out fur amid a backlash from consumers. The retailer plans to close all of its fur salons by the end of fiscal 2021 and to stop using fur by the end of fiscal 2022. That includes both brand partner and store-label merchandis­e sold online and in stores. The retailer joins a growing list of companies and brands that have stopped selling fur, including Macy’s, Versace and Prada. Shearling, goatskin, cattle hide, down, feathers, leather and faux fur products will continue to be sold online and in stores, Saks said.
